Surface plasmons in small Au-Ag alloy particles

G. C. Papavassiliou1976-04-01Journal of Physics F Metal Physics

The optical absorption spectra in 2-butanol have been studied. The position of the absorption peak which is attributed to surface plasmons of small alloy particles depends on the composition of the alloy. The spectra obtained are qualitatively in agreement with those calculated by Mie's equation.

Liquid Crystalline Structure In Aqueous Hydroxypropyl Cellulose Solutions

Rita S. Werbowyj、Derek G. Gray1976-04-01OpenAlex

Concentrated aqueous solutions of hydroxypropyl cellulose form lyotropic mesophases displaying a range of iridescent colors. Evidence from light microscopy and optical rotatory dispersion suggests that the mesophase has helicoidal structure, resembling in some respects that of cholesteric liquid crystals.
